Output 12dd76f235f652927acd1f3afa39d10af84522dc667367a8b01b3069f1ccb533:38

value
11658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be0aa87a2fba2a31e5720578266b50aff692b4e6 OP_EQUAL
address
3K1s5XiCg1u7xHHoZ8AQQz2VzQZuYQdCf2
transaction
12dd76f235f652927acd1f3afa39d10af84522dc667367a8b01b3069f1ccb533
spent
true